  • Patent number: 9506424
    Abstract: A device and a method for bleeding compressor air in an engine includes at least one actuator and at least one closing element linked to the actuator for closing or partially closing a bypass duct via which compressor air can be bled off. It is provided here that the closing element is designed to be successively moved into the bypass duct, with the airflow passing through the bypass duct being settable by the position of the closing element. Furthermore, an air guiding device linked to the closing element is provided and has air guiding surfaces which adjoin the closing element downstream, the spatial alignment of the air guiding surfaces being dependent on the position of the closing element.

  • Publication number: 20160123235
    Abstract: An assembly and a method for bleeding of compressor air in an engine is provided. The assembly includes a bleed channel for bleeding compressor air. It is provided that the channel geometry of the bleed channel is adjustable.
